Output 91e624b65d7fbe8265097180c9617459476f077faf4d23762be238bc99537a6f:266

value
2879
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5c18f0d620ff0d8a84fccd6e6d75b559a9d65d6995c332e70fe8358095c0dcc8
address
bc1ptsv0p43qluxc4p8ue4hx6ad4tx5avhtfjhpn9ec0aq6cp9wqmnyqc4k9nq
transaction
91e624b65d7fbe8265097180c9617459476f077faf4d23762be238bc99537a6f